2.1.3. Positioning the Equipment

Position the equipment with the following points in mind.

• Rest the Platform on a smooth

surface, within 1/8”, and on a level
plane, within ¼” across both the
length and width of the platform .

• The four corners of the Platform must

rest solidly on the surface, and not
rock. Unlevel flooring and foreign
material under the Platform can cause
an “out-of-level” condition, and the
weight readings could be incorrect.

• Platform vibrations may also affect the

weighing accuracy. Wherever
possible, locate the platform as far
away from heavy, low frequency
vibrations as much as possible.

• Do not load the platform if there is any

evidence of damage to the platform or
supporting structure.

• Ease of access is very important.

Allow plenty of room for maneuvering
a loaded dolly.

• Reading the Indicator is also important to workers, so place it in a very visible

position.

• The scale is to be placed on a flat, solid, level surface, one that fully supports the

weight of the platform plus a full capacity load.

Whenever moving the scale to another location, it is important to locate the

Scale on a level area using the

Bubble Level

in the center of the Platform

for accurate and consistent weighing.
